On Monday 27th December we host our festive final event in our mini 3 round GC series which will be held at Les Quennevais. An opportunity for us all to lose a few of those extra pounds put on over Christmas!
We encourage everyone to get fully into the Christmas spirit and will have spot prizes for best dressed rider and best decorated bike.
The format for the event will be similar to previous events where there will be two races 'Elite' and 'Sport' with separate categories for Ladies within each race. The Ladies races will start 2 minutes ahead of the rest of the field.
The Elite race will be approximately 50 minutes in duration. Whilst Juniors and Youth riders will be accepted, they must be minimum 2nd year Youth B and endorsed by the Coaching team of the JYC. The event will be limited to 50 riders and the Organisers reserve the right to move riders to the Sport race if oversubscribed.
The Sport race will be run over the same (or similar) course and will be approximately 30 minutes in duration. The Sport race is intended to be a fun race and is perfectly suited to both newcomers and experienced riders. Juniors and Youth riders will be accepted, they must be minimum Youth B. The event will be limited to 50 riders.
Any riders lapped during the race will have the same time as their slowest lap + 1 minute added to their overall time to ensure all riders have a race time for the same numbers of laps The series winner in each category will be the one to have completed all 3 races in the shortest overall time in the same way as a stage race on the road.. Gridding will be based on current GC positions after round 2.
The timetable of events will be a bit later than usual:
11.30 - 11.45 - Course familiarisation
11.50 - 12.20 - CX Sport - 30 mins
12.30 - 12.45 - Course familiarisation
12.50 - 13.40 - CX Elite - 50 mins
Sign on will be online with race number chips available from 11.15 at the JYC Clubhouse. Entries on the day will NOT be accepted.
